Optional Redemption: | | Prior to May 15, 2043, the bonds will be redeemable, in whole at any time or in part from time to time, at a redemption price equal to the greater of (i) 100% of the principal amount of the bonds being redeemed and (ii) the sum of the present values of the remaining scheduled payments of principal and interest discounted on a semi-annual basis at the Adjusted Treasury Rate, plus 15 basis points; plus, in either case, accrued and unpaid interest to the Redemption Date. On or after May 15, 2043, the bonds will be redeemable at a redemption price equal to 100% of the principal amount of the bonds being redeemed, plus accrued and unpaid interest to the Redemption Date. |

Under Rule 15c6-1 under the Exchange Act, trades in the secondary market are required to settle in three business days, unless the parties to any such trade expressly agree otherwise. Accordingly, purchasers who wish to trade Bonds prior to the settlement date will be required, by virtue of the fact that the Bonds initially will settle in T+5, to specify an alternate settlement arrangement at the time of any such trade to prevent a failed settlement. Purchasers of the Bonds who wish to trade the Bonds prior to the settlement date should consult their advisors.
